E93 LCI tails - issue with retrofit harness

Howdy

I have an may 2009 builddate E93 and installed LCI tails with retrofit harness.
Drivers side works fully but passengers side nothing works, no lights at all.

When I look at the harness, it has a separate part number 2181308 drivers side and 2181307 passengers side.
But when I look which wire connects with what then both sides have identical connections (though using different colors) did I get a bad set ?

I can use any one on the drivers side and it works. See picture, what's wrong ?

You need to re-arrange the wires on the passenger side. Also the trunk lights needs to be re wired also. Basically it has to mirror the drivers side.

here is the wiring for passenger side...make sure you see the pins it suppose to connect to the original harnass on passenger side...from pins 1-6 and then re wire the lci harnass to the exact colors I just posted that way when it mates with the oem harnass the wiring is exactly as I posted below

After its wired correctly, you are going to need some coding done to the car to make the lci work correctly...You will have super fast blinking blinkers and possible a turn signal malfunction.

just an update. So I had the drivers side mostly working, and the passengers side not at all. Then I mirrored the passengers side from the pinout from the drivers side. With your chart I noticed three wires were still not right, after correcting them on both sides I now have everything working. Still a mistory to me why two shipped sets of retrofit harnesses didn't work...

The e93 lights are different in their wiring arrangements compared to the e92. And the conversion actually needs 4 harnesses as opposed to just 2 on the e92. The little lights on the boot need harnesses on the e93. Im telling you this from experience. You'll need to order a news set of harnesses from you dealer.
